Here’s how to link your Wilmington security system with Google Nest or Amazon's Alexa:

Turn On The ADT Control Using The Alexa or Google App

To switch on voice commands on your security and automation system, you’ll want to activate the ADT Control skill in the Alexa or Google Nest app. Then you can instruct your devices to perform almost all of the things that you can manage in your mobile security app. With intuitive voice commands, you can arm or disarm your alarms and sensors, raise or lower your smart lighting and smart thermostat, or see if the garage door is up.

Conversely, you can use separate skills to control each camera, alarm, and automation component, but that can become a bit unwieldy. One of the benefits of linking your Wilmington security system to Google Nest or Alexa is that every voice command for every component is found in the same place. What Voice Commands Can You Issue When You Pair Your Wilmington Security System To Google Nest or Alexa?

Your AI assistant can do more than just turning on the lights or arming your alarms. You might want to find out the status of your sensors or change a component to a preset level. You may also command your AI assistant to auto-adjust your components just like you could in the ADT app.

Say these phrases for your Alexa or Google Nest:

  • “Arm my home security system.”

  • “Lock the front door.”

  • “Turn off my bedroom light.”

  • “Did I set the alarms?”

  • “Record a clip from my garage door camera.”

  • “What temperature is my thermostat?”

You can also preset a routine in Google or Alexa that combines many devices together. For instance, say “Alexa, I’m leaving the house,” and trigger your smart door locks, flip on your alarms, lower the thermostat, and extinguish your smart lights. Or preset a routine for “tv time,” and use the prompt to turn down the lights and put the thermostat to just the right level. The devices you can pair together for a personalized routine are seemingly endless.

Should You Order All Your Automated Items From One Place Or Mix And Match?

Does connecting your Wilmington security system to Alexa or Google Nest work best if you get your devices from the initial install, or can you pick over time? While you can mix and match -- as long as your device uses z-wave wireless connections -- sometimes it’s more convenient to get all your security components linked at the time of install.

When you get your security, safety, and automation devices installed together, you create one unified system from the outset. Then you can pre-set away and create groups, routines, and custom commands, and not have to reprogram later. You could get different security devices as you go, but then you will have to troubleshoot to get them to work in sync. Just make sure that any extra alarms, cameras, or smart items are entered to your security system first, and then prompt Alexa or Google through the ADT voice prompts.
